if you plan on getting into homebrew stuff I would highly suggest looking into a new 3ds as the higher clock speed opens up more possibilities. One that comes to mind(just for example, there are many more) is the retroarch playstation emulator. Better gba emulation and snes emulation as well. There is also a n3ds exclusive custom firmware called ntr cfw that has some cool features. If you're on a budget though 2ds will still let you install games, and it certainly is cheaper
